The puncture kit in your boot fixes the leak and writes off the tyre
A screw in the middle of the tread is one of the cheapest things that can go wrong with a car, right up until the moment you fix it yourself.
European workshop practice on this is unusually clear and unusually generous. Continental sets it out for the German market in a single line: a repair has to sit within the middle three quarters of the tread, the zone the trade calls the small repair area, and the hole may be up to six millimetres across. The ADAC draws the line a shade tighter, at five millimetres, a difference your fitter settles rather than you, but between them they cover the overwhelming majority of real punctures, because a wood screw is around four millimetres and a roofing nail is less. Michelin works to the same six millimetre ceiling and adds the condition that governs everything else, which is that the tyre must come off the wheel so a professional can inspect the inside, since the damage that rules out a repair is almost never the hole you can see from outside. Step beyond that band and the answer reverses without argument. The shoulder, where the tread rolls over into the sidewall, and the sidewall itself are structural, and Continental's wording leaves no room at all: damage there is never repairable. All of which means a nail in the tread ought to be a twenty minute job costing somewhere between twenty-five and fifty euros across most of Europe, against eighty to well over two hundred for a replacement. The reason so many drivers end up paying the second figure is sitting in their boot, in the space where a spare wheel used to be.
Sealant seals the puncture and ends the tyre's life in the same movement
This is the part nobody mentions when a new car is handed over without a spare wheel. The ADAC states it flatly: after using the sealant from one of these kits, a professional repair of that tyre by a specialist firm is, for various technical reasons, no longer permitted. Continental says the same thing in fewer words still, that once sealant has been introduced no tyre may be repaired. The bottle is therefore not a cheaper version of a repair, it is a substitute for one, and squeezing it in converts a tyre you would have got back for the price of a tank of fuel into a tyre you are buying again. There is a second bill hiding behind it, because the same liquid coats the inside of the rim and can block the port on the pressure sensor mounted at the valve, a component in its own right and not a cheap one to replace. That matters more than it sounds, because your tyre pressure warning light is not a pressure gauge, and a sensor that has been gummed up tends to go quiet rather than complain. Worth knowing too: the kit was never a permanent fix in the first place, since it caps you at around 80 km/h over a limited distance, and the bottle carries an expiry date, commonly four to five years out, that almost nobody in Europe has ever looked at.
Driving on a flat ruins the tyre from the inside, whatever the hole looks like
The German trade has a word for it, Plattrollschaden, the damage done by rolling on a flat, and the ADAC lists it alongside sidewall cuts as an automatic replacement rather than a repair. Michelin explains the mechanism: run a tyre flat or badly underinflated and the structure itself is damaged, and once the carcass is weakened the tyre cannot be repaired even when the puncture sits squarely in the tread. That single fact turns the roadside instinct almost everybody has, which is to find the screw and pull it out, into the most expensive move available. A screw or a nail in the tread very often seals around itself well enough to hold usable pressure for days, and the moment you remove it you have converted a slow leak you could have driven to a garage into a flat you cannot. Leave the object exactly where it is, check the pressure, top it up if you carry a compressor, and drive gently and directly to a fitter.
A plug pushed in from outside is a get-you-home fix, not a repair
The string kits sold in every accessory shop, and the plugs some fast-fit outlets still push through the tread without taking the wheel off, do not meet the standard the European tyre trade works to. A compliant repair means demounting the tyre, inspecting the inner liner for the scuffing and rubber crumbs that betray a tyre run underinflated, then fitting a combination repair unit that fills the hole and patches the liner from the inside, where air pressure holds it against the casing instead of trying to push it out. Anything done through the tread from outside leaves the inside uninspected, and the inspection is the entire point of the exercise. Ask for one more thing while the wheel is off the car: the patch adds weight to a single spot on the tyre, so the wheel needs balancing again afterwards, and a steering wheel that shakes at 100 km/h is usually a ten gram problem.
On run-flats the tyre makers genuinely disagree with each other
This is the one place with no single European answer, so asking beats assuming. Continental advises against repairing run-flat tyres at all, on the grounds that conventional repair methods can be unsafe and unreliable on that construction. Michelin takes the opposite view for its own ZP range and permits a repair once, and once only, following the normal inspection and repair procedure. The practical difficulty behind the disagreement is that a run-flat's reinforced sidewall is designed to carry the car with no pressure in it, which means the driver frequently has no idea how far the tyre was driven deflated, and the inspector cannot always tell either. What to actually do
Most of the money in this is won or lost in the first five minutes at the roadside, before anyone has properly looked at the tyre.
Leave the nail or screw exactly where it is. It is very often sealing the hole it made well enough to hold pressure, and pulling it out is what turns a repairable tyre into a flat one.
Check the pressure and watch how fast it falls. If the tyre holds enough air to reach a fitter at moderate speed, that is the best possible outcome for it, and by a distance the cheapest.
Look at where the damage sits before you spend anything. Anywhere in the middle three quarters of the tread and you are probably fine. In the shoulder or the sidewall the tyre is finished and no repair is coming, whatever it cost last year.
Treat the sealant bottle as the last resort it actually is, not the first thing you reach for. A space-saver, a roadside callout or a tow all leave the tyre repairable. The bottle does not.
If sealant did go in, say so before the fitter touches the wheel. It changes what they are allowed to do and it gives them a chance to save the pressure sensor rather than discover it the hard way.
Insist the tyre comes off the wheel. A repair carried out without demounting and inspecting the inner liner is not a repair, whatever the invoice calls it.
Ask for the wheel to be rebalanced once the patch is in, and check that it appears on the bill. A patch is weight added to one point of a rotating assembly.
Check the expiry date on the sealant bottle in your boot this week. Four to five years is typical, and an expired bottle leaves you with a puncture kit that will not seal and a tyre nobody is allowed to repair afterwards either.
If your car wears run-flats, find out your tyre maker's position now rather than at the roadside, because the makers do not agree and the fitter will follow the name on the sidewall.
Frequently asked questions
Can a punctured car tyre be repaired in Europe?
Usually yes, provided the damage sits in the middle three quarters of the tread and is no bigger than about six millimetres, which covers most screws and nails. The tyre has to come off the wheel so a professional can inspect the inside. Damage in the shoulder or the sidewall is never repairable, and neither is a tyre that was driven flat.
Does tyre sealant ruin the tyre?
In practice, yes. The ADAC says that after using the sealant from a puncture kit, a professional repair by a specialist firm is no longer permitted, and Continental states the same rule outright. Sealant is designed to get you off a motorway, not to save the tyre. It can also block the pressure sensor at the valve, which is a separate replacement cost on top of the tyre.
Should I pull the nail out of my tyre?
No. The object is usually sealing the hole it made, and removing it at the roadside can turn a tyre that would have held pressure all the way to the garage into a flat one. A tyre driven flat gets replaced rather than repaired, so the two minutes with the pliers can cost you the tyre. Leave it in, check the pressure, and drive gently to a fitter.
Can one tyre be repaired more than once?
In principle yes, as long as every repair sits inside the repair area and the repairs do not overlap or crowd each other, but that is a judgement the fitter makes with the tyre off the wheel and the inside in front of them, not one anybody can make from a photograph. A tyre showing several previous repairs, visible ageing or exposed cords gets refused, and should.
Can run-flat tyres be repaired?
It depends who made them. Continental advises against it. Michelin allows a single repair on its ZP tyres following the normal procedure. The complication is that a run-flat can be driven a long way with no pressure at all without looking dramatic, so the fitter is often being asked to vouch for something they cannot see. Ask your tyre maker's position before you assume either way.
How much does a puncture repair cost against a new tyre?
Across most of western Europe a professional repair lands somewhere between twenty-five and fifty euros, while a mid-range replacement for a family car starts around eighty and runs well past two hundred in larger or performance sizes. The repair also keeps the set matched, which matters on a car whose other three tyres are half worn.
